Medium Neutral Citation: Butler Street Community Network Incorporated v Northern Region Joint Regional Planning Panel [2017] NSWLEC 51 Hearing dates: 28 April 2017 Date of orders: 05 May 2017 Decision date: 05 May 2017 Jurisdiction: Class 1 Before: Robson J Decision: See orders at [49] Catchwords: PRACTICE AND PROCEDURE – development consent by a public authority for the purposes of a road – whether the Court has jurisdiction where the bulk of the development is permissible without consent Legislation Cited: Byron Local Environmental Plan 2014 (NSW) Environmental Planning and Assessment Act 1979 (NSW) ss 80, 98 Environmental Planning and Assessment Regulation 2000 (NSW) cl 55 Land and Environment Court Act 1979 (NSW) s 39 Land and Environment Court Rules 2007 (NSW) r 3.7 State Environmental Planning Policy No 14 – Coastal Wetlands (NSW) cl 7 State Environmental Planning Policy (Infrastructure) 2007 (NSW) cll 8, 94 Cases Cited: Addenbrooke Pty Ltd v Woollahra Municipal Council (No 2) [2009] NSWLEC 134 Calvin v Carr (1979) 1 NSWLR 1 Chambers v Maclean Shire Council [2003] NSWCA 100; (2003) 126 LGERA 7 Currey v Sutherland Shire Council and Russell [2003] NSWCA 300; (2003) 129 LGERA 223 Ervin Mahrer and Partners v Strathfield Municipal Council (No 2) [2001] NSWLEC 140; (2001) 115 LGERA 259 Hoxton Park Residents Action Group Inc v Liverpool City Council [2011] NSWCA 349; (2011) 184 LGERA 104 Lend Lease Development Pty Ltd v Manly Council (1997) 92 LGERA 420 Radray Constructions Pty Ltd v Hornsby Council [2006] NSWLEC 155; (2006) 145 LGERA 292 Rogers v Clarence Valley Council [2011] NSWLEC 134; (2011) 185 LGERA 37 The Council of the City of Parramatta v Precision Rubber Service Pty Limited [1995] NSWLEC 34 Category: Procedural and other rulings Parties: Butler Street Community Network Incorporated (Applicant) Northern Region Joint Regional Planning Panel (First Respondent) GHD Pty Ltd (Second Respondent) Byron Shire Council (Third Respondent) Representation: Counsel: F Berglund with N Hammond (Applicant) L Sims, solicitor (First Respondent) A Galasso SC (Third Respondent)
